Getting home finance can be quite tough when your credit rating is not good. If you are in this situation you should look into FHA loans before speaking with a bank. Even if the applicant does not have money for closing costs or a down payment, an FHA loan is workable.

Fixing credit reports must begin with a solid working plan that you are capable of adhering to. You must make a commitment to making changes on how you spend money. Only buy what you absolutely need. Before purchasing an item, ask yourself if it is absolutely necessary and well within your financial means. If you cannot answer each of these in the affirmative, do not buy the item.

If your credit is top-notch, getting a mortgage is a simple matter. Paying down your mortgage improves your score as well. Owning a valuable asset like a house will improve your financial stability and make you appear more creditworthy. If you have to borrow some money, you will need this.

To improve your credit rating, set up an installment account. An installment account requires that you make a minimum payment each month. It is imperative that you only take an installment account that is affordable. If you use these accounts, your score will go up rapidly.

Before you choose a credit counseling agency, find out more about them. Although some credit counselors are truthful and legitimately helpful, other credit counselors are not honest and upfront with their motives. Some are not legitimate. It is wise for consumers to not give out personal information unless they are absolutely sure that the company is legit.

Be very wary of programs that do not sound legal; chances are they aren’t. The Internet is rife with many scams that will go into detail about creating yourself a brand new credit file and making the old one magically disappear. Creating a new credit file is very illegal and you can be easily caught. The legal consequences are expensive, and you might be sentenced to jail.

Taking time to examine your monthly credit card bill is critical to ensure that there are no errors. Should there be any mistakes, contact the company and talk to them to avoid being reported to the credit companies.

Do not file for bankruptcy if you do not have to. It is noted on someone’s credit report for 10 years. Though the idea of ridding yourself of debt can sound appealing, the long term consequences just aren’t worth it. If credit repair is something you have been considering, the first step would be to pay down your credit card balances. Pay down credit cards that have the highest amount owed, or the highest interest rates. This will show future creditors that you take your debts seriously.

It is important for you to thoroughly look over your monthly credit card statements. Look for any changes that have happened, and make sure they are correct. You do not want to end up paying for a purchase that you did not make. It is solely your responsibility to be sure that everything is correct.

Try lowering the balance of any revolving accounts you have. Reducing the amount of debt you’re carrying is one of the best ways to improve your credit score. The FICO system will make a note when the balances are at 20, 40, 60, 80 and 100 percent of the total credit available.
